Digitas - Digital Marketing services, Scotland, UK
DigitasDigitas - Digitas is a global marketing and technology agency that transforms businesses for the digital age.
Digital Marketing services, Scotland.
Digitas, 15 Atholl Cres, Edinburgh EH3 8HA, United Kingdom, EH3 8HA, UK
+44 131 555 4848
https://www.digitas.com
Digital Marketing Services offered in Scotland:
Quick Digital Marketing enquiry to Digitas: